The cheapest way to get from Bridlington to Rillington is to drive which costs £6 - £10 and takes 36 min.
The fastest way to get from Bridlington to Rillington is to drive which takes 36 min and costs £6 - £10.
No, there is no direct bus from Bridlington to Rillington. However, there are services departing from Bridlington BS and arriving at Coach and Horses via Rail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 12m.
The distance between Bridlington and Rillington is 41 miles. The road distance is 25.9 miles.
The best way to get from Bridlington to Rillington without a car is to train and line 843 bus which takes 1h 37m and costs .
It takes approximately 1h 37m to get from Bridlington to Rillington, including transfers.
